В редакторе переменных можно сразу изменить любое количество параметров модели. В редакторе переменных можно использовать формульные зависимости, множество разнообразных функций (математических, тригонометрических, отбора из БД, геометрических, условного выбора…). Действия в редакторе переменных могут производиться как над числовыми параметрами, так и над тестовыми параметрами.
Параметрическая модель теплообменника позволяет выпускать практически готовую документацию на новый вид теплообменника по заявке Заказчика. Заявка выполнена тоже в системе T-FLEX CAD.
При Заказчике вносятся требования к проектируемому теплообменнику, все данные сохраняются в базу данных, с которой связаны параметрические модели чертежей всех элементов теплообменника. После сохранения требований Заказчика в базу данных необходимо открыть соответствующие чертежи и вызвать стандартный пересчет параметрической модели в T-FLEX CAD. Внутри чертежей теплообменника помимо расчета геометрии, также введены расчеты по теплообмену, расчету витков трубок теплообмена и т.д. В результате пересчета параметрической модели получаются практически готовые чертежи на требуемую конструкцию теплообменника.
С помощью произвольных формульных зависимостей с использованием арифметических действий, скобок, богатого набора математических и других функций, а также условных выражений. Пример показывает, что любой параметр модели может быть задан с помощью переменной. В T-FLEX CAD очень просто можно связать любые геометрические параметры (и не только) между собой в добавление к уже заданным геометрическим зависимостям.
Автор: Ефимова Светлана Николаевна
Предприятие: ОАО "Елецгидроагрегат"
Продукты T-FLEX, применявшиеся при проектировании: T-FLEX CAD 3D
Проект-победитель конкурса проектов "Эксперт"
Основными задачами, которые ставились при выполнении этого проекта являлись оптимальная унификация конструкции деталей и гидроцилиндра в целом, сокращение трудоемкости и себестоимости проектирования гидроцилиндров, а так же автоматизация оформления конструкторской документации.
Пример параметрического сборочного чертежа с достаточно сложной геометрией показывает, что геометрические параметры могут быть завязаны от любых других параметров, например, от номинального усилия пресса. Изменение усилия пресса приводит к автоматическому пересчету зависимостей геометрических параметров, отбору недостающих параметров из БД и получению нового варианта сборочного чертежа пресса.
Геометрические параметры самой модели могут участвовать в параметрическом пересчете модели и задавать значения других параметров модели. Пример шнека с геометрически изменяемым шагом показывает, что шаг винта задан с помощью 2D сплайна. Изменение геометрии сплайна приводит к автоматическому изменению шага 3D модели шнека.
В T-FLEX CAD имеется встроенный редактор таблиц (БД), в котором можно создавать таблицы (внутренние базы данных). На примере показывается, что элементы библиотек стандартных элементов T-FLEX CAD построены на основе целого набора таблиц, соответствующих ГОСТ, и при изменении базовых параметров – все остальные параметры элементов отбираются из внутренних БД и получается новый стандартный элемент.
T-FLEX CAD позволяет назначать параметры на различные взаимосвязи. К таким параметрам могут относиться как численные (размерные и параметры другого рода), так и текстовые параметры. Для примера «Фреза» конструктор задал возможность параметрического изменения ширины фрезы, количества зубьев фрезы и количества облегчающих отверстий.
В T-FLEX CAD возможно управление слоями чертежа (модели) и уровнями видимости любых элементов. Простейший пример не из машиностроения, красиво демонстрирует параметрическое управление уровнями видимости элементов и слоями чертежа.
T-FLEX CAD содержит в стандартной поставке полноценный модуль оптимизации, который позволяет решать различные оптимизационные задачи. Помимо решения стандартных задач по оптимизации параметров моделей T-FLEX CAD позволяет включить оптимизацию в параметрический пересчет модели. Пример показывает решение оптимизационной задачи по нахождению угла положения ролика, чтобы длина ремня была равна 1000. Данный пример показывает, как с помощью модуля оптимизации решается задача оптимального подбора 5 параметров -- углов роликов, чтобы длина ремня была минимальной.
Пример демонстрирует, что в уже показанную ранее модель можно загрузить рассчитанные не в системе T-FLEX CAD значения параметров через файл простого формата, а система T-FLEX CAD перестроит параметрическую модель.
Пример построения «вафельной» оболочки с помощью специальной команды «параметрический массив». При изменении размеров проектируемой оболочки «параметрический массив» автоматически перестраивается в соответствие с заданными условиями заполнения.
Для создания диалога в T-FLEX CAD создается специальная страница, на которой просто рисуется необходимый диалог и расставляются элементы управления различных типов для управления параметрами модели. Созданный диалог потом вызывается на экран и управляет моделью. При создании диалогов существует возможность параметризации самих пользовательских диалогов. Также для диалогов имеется возможность подключения макросов и приложений для редактирования переменных модели.
Пример параметрической «ванны» или очистного сооружения разработан на одном из польских предприятий. Вся номенклатура таких «ванн» была заложена в одной параметрической модели T-FLEX CAD! В результате данное предприятие получает необходимую документацию на любое заказанное изделие для своего производства за считанные минуты. Конструктор просто задает необходимые элементы конструкции и их параметры, а T-FLEX CAD пересчитывает параметрическую модель и получает готовое изделие. Великолепное применение параметрических возможностей системы T-FLEX CAD! Браво, наши польские друзья!
Пример демонстрирует вариативность параметрической модели с параметрическим управлением «подавлением» операций. Пример выполнен без применения «конфигураций» так как вариантов комбинаций получается достаточно много.
С помощью специальной команды «Отношения», которая показывает ранее установленные пользователем отношения между элементами параметрической модели T-FLEX CAD. Задавая значения параметров можно изменять параметрическую модель. Графические объекты – маркеры, показывающие отношения между элементами можно оставить на экране с тем, чтобы можно было отслеживать их изменения в «прозрачном режиме».
В примере показывается автоматический пересчет в соответствие с ГОСТ полей допусков при изменении размеров чертежа. T-FLEX CAD автоматически отслеживает изменение допусков и других элементов оформления при параметрическом изменении модели. В результате конструктор не должен следить за правильностью оформления чертежа – система это делает за него.
Графики могут использоваться для задания закона изменения одного параметра от другого. Примеры демонстрируют возможность использования графиков для задания значений переменного радиуса для сглаживания.
Еще один пример показывает, что с помощью графиков также можно управлять углом кручения тела по траектории и масштабированием профиля, который движется по траектории.
«Вырождение» касается не только параметров модели, но и элементов оформления. На представленном примере все элементы сами убираются при вырождении и сами восстанавливаются при необходимости – это обеспечивает параметрическая модель T-FLEX CAD. «Вырождение» параметров работает как в 2D, так и в 3D.
«Вырождение» касается не только параметров модели, но и элементов оформления. На представленном примере все элементы сами убираются при вырождении и сами восстанавливаются при необходимости – это обеспечивает параметрическая модель T-FLEX CAD. «Вырождение» параметров работает как в 2D, так и в 3D.